[Measuring mental performance: an old idea and a new approach]

Summary
This study introduces a method to measure mental performance by analyzing thought organization. Simpler cognitive structures lead to better problem-solving and higher EEG alpha band performance.

Summary:
- The study proposes measuring mental performance through the 'formation of order' in thought, defined by complexity-reducing structuring.
- A measurement process based on the symbol-distance effect was developed for elementary problem-solving.
- Results indicate that individuals with more parsimonious cognitive structures achieve better solutions to complex problems.
- Complexity reduction, measured by EEG alpha band performance, correlates positively with cognitive efficiency.
